100 INVESTMENTS LIMITED v PVG SECURITIES TRUSTEE LIMITED [2020] NZCA 458
- Citation
- [2020] NZCA 458
- Court
- Court of Appeal
The application to enforce the undertaking as to damages was an interlocutory application within the meaning of the Senior Courts Act and High Court Rules (ancillary to the relief claimed in the pleadings), therefore High Court leave under s56(3) should have been sought; the Court of Appeal stayed the appeal pending leave or declination by the High Court and directed procedure if leave is refused.
